Rich Link-Vorschauen mit Onebox erstellen

:bookmark: Dies ist eine Anleitung zur Erstellung reichhaltiger Link-Vorschauen mit Onebox in Discourse. Sie erklärt, wie man Oneboxes erstellt, Inline-Oneboxing verwendet, Oneboxing vermeidet, Hyperlinks verwendet und erweiterte iFrames behandelt.

:person_raising_hand: Erforderliches Benutzerniveau: Alle Benutzer

Onebox wandelt Ihre Weblinks in nützliche Vorschau-Ausschnitte um, die den Lesern helfen, sich über das Ziel zu informieren, bevor sie darauf klicken.

Zusammenfassung

Diese Anleitung behandelt, wie man:

  • Oneboxes erstellt
  • Inline-Oneboxing verwendet
  • Oneboxing vermeidet
  • Hyperlinks anstelle von Oneboxing verwendet
  • Erweiterte iFrames behandelt

Eine Onebox erstellen

Um eine Onebox zu erstellen, fügen Sie einfach einen beliebigen Link in einer eigenen Zeile in einen Beitrag ein, wie folgt:

https://www.google.com/

Dies führt zu:

Onebox unterstützt allgemeine oEmbed- und OpenGraph-Tags und verfügt über benutzerdefinierte Regeln für beliebte Seiten wie Wikipedia, Twitter, Amazon, YouTube und andere.

Versuchen Sie, Links in Ihre Beiträge einzufügen und zu sehen, was passiert. Denken Sie nur daran, dass der Link in einer eigenen Zeile stehen muss, damit Oneboxing funktioniert!

Inline-Oneboxing

Wenn die Website-Einstellung enable inline onebox on all domains aktiviert ist (diese Funktion ist standardmäßig aktiviert), ersetzt das Einfügen des Links inline mit dem Text den Rohlink durch den Titel der Seite, wie hier Understanding Discourse Trust Levels

like this https://blog.discourse.org/2018/06/understanding-discourse-trust-levels/

Oneboxes vermeiden

Wenn der Link als einfacher, unverzierter Rohlink angezeigt werden soll, setzen Sie ihn in \u003c Klammern \u003e:

\u003chttps://blog.discourse.org/2018/06/understanding-discourse-trust-levels/\u003e

Alternativ können Sie ein Leerzeichen vor dem Link oder beliebige Zeichen nach dem Link einfügen.

Hyperlinks verwenden

Sie können Ihrem Text einen Link hinzufügen, indem Sie:

  • Auf die Kettenglied-Schaltfläche in der Editor-Symbolleiste klicken
  • Text in Ihrem Beitrag auswählen und einen Link aus Ihrer Zwischenablage einfügen
  • Markdown / BBCode / HTML-Links hinzufügen:
[link here](https://example.com)
[link=https://example.com]link here[/link]
\u003ca href=\"https://example.com\"\u003elink here\u003c/a\u003e

Erweiterte iFrames

Standardmäßig ist \u003ciframe\u003e aus Sicherheitsgründen blockiert. Wenn die iFrames jedoch von hochgradig vertrauenswürdigen Quellen stammen, kann ein Discourse-Administrator diese Domain zur Website-Einstellung allowed iframes hinzufügen.

Möglicherweise müssen Sie auch den vollständigen Einbettungscode einfügen, wie den für die folgende Karte:

\u003ciframe src=\"https://www.google.com/maps/embed?pb=!1m18!1m12!1m3!1d24202.451099423397!2d-74.06201522657554!3d40.68924937923285!2m3!1f0!2f0!3f0!3m2!1i1024!2i768!4f13.1!3m3!1m2!1s0x89c25090129c363d%3A0x40c6a5770d25022b!2sStatue+of+Liberty+National+Monument!5e0!3m2!1sen!2suk!4v1533203877892\" width=\"600\" height=\"450\" frameborder=\"0\" style=\"border:0\" allowfullscreen\u003e\u003c/iframe\u003e

Dies führt zu:

\u003ciframe src="https://www.google.com/maps/embed?pb=!1m18!1m12!1m3!1d24202.451099423397!2d-74.06201522657554!3d40.68924937923285!2m3!1f0!2f0!3f0!3m2!1i1024!2i768!4f13.1!3m3!1m2!1s0x89c25090129c363d%3A0x40c6a5770d25022b!2sStatue+of+Liberty+National+Monument!5e0!3m2!1sen!2suk!4v1533203877892\" width="600" height="450" frameborder="0" style="border:0" allowfullscreen\u003e\u003c/iframe\u003e

Zusätzliche Ressourcen

Für weitere Informationen und zur Fehlerbehebung bei Oneboxes besuchen Sie bitte das verwandte Thema unten:

46 „Gefällt mir“